For years I've had this quote posted on my cubicle wall at work because I knew, intuitively, that it contained vast wisdom. Now, years later, more water has flowed under the bridge and now I know they are true from personal experience, and am so grateful for the seeds these quotes planted in me. Here is quote from Paul Ferrini's Love Without Conditions: "You will find all kinds of methods to teach you 'how to be'. But, as long as there is a method, you will be 'doing'. I am telling you to drop all your methods. They are not necessary. Simply cease judging, interpreting, conceptualizing, speculating. Let all that is not 'being' fall away. And then being will flower of itself. Then grace will unfold out of the seeming randomness of events. And you will understand the meaning and be glad that it is so. "There is no one who would shrink from his purpose here once it has been revealed to him. But it cannot reveal itself as long as he is trying to force his life open. "Be patient. Be gentle. All the joy and beauty of your life is at hand now. Your purpose is fully manifesting in this moment. "Do not look for meaning outside your own experience. Just trust what is and be with it. That is the most profound teaching I can give you. For, in this simple practice, all the barriers to truth will come down."
